Job Description

The role
This is not a traditional Medical Director role. You will be working with and visiting providers within Norther New Jersey.

You’ll sit at the center of how Clover drives clinical quality, cost performance, and provider behavior change across our network—working directly with physicians to improve outcomes at scale.

Your mandate is simple:
turn data into action, and action into better care, better outcomes and more efficient care.

You’ll partner with clinicians on the ground, using data, coaching, and technology ( Clover Assistant) to influence how care is delivered—day to day, patient by patient.

What you’ll do

  • Partner directly with network physicians and care teams to improve quality, outcomes, and total cost of care
  • Identify performance gaps and translate data into clear, actionable clinical changes
  • Coach providers (1:1 and group) on evidence-based care, documentation, and population health strategies
  • Drive adoption and effective use of Clover Assistant in real clinical workflows
  • Be the tip of the spear for implementation of clinical programs with partner providers
  • Build trusted relationships with clinicians—serving as a peer advisor, not just a directive voice
  • Collaborate with Operations, Analytics, and Provider Success to align clinical and business goals
  • Support and mentor market-level clinical leaders to drive performance across the network

What winning looks like

  • Measurable improvement in clinical quality metrics and patient outcomes
  • Reduction in total cost of care through better clinical decision-making
  • Increased provider engagement and consistent use of Clover Assistant
  • Providers change behavior—not just understand the data
  • Strong, trusted relationships across the provider network

Why this role is hard (and worth it)

  • You’re influencing clinicians—without direct authority
  • Changing clinical behavior is complex and requires trust, credibility, and persistence
  • You’ll need to balance data, clinical judgment, and real-world constraints
  • Your impact is highly visible—and directly tied to patient outcome

Who you are

  • MD or DO with an active, unrestricted license; board certified (Primary Care preferred)
  • Clinically credible with 5+ years of practice experience
  • Experience in value-based care, population health, or risk-based models (MSO, ACO, MA)
  • Proven ability to influence and coach peer clinicians
  • Comfortable using data to drive clinical decisions and behavior change
  • High comfort with EMRs, clinical tools, and technology-enabled care models
  • Strong communicator who builds trust quickly with physicians and care teams

About Clover Health

Clover Health (Nasdaq: CLOV) is a physician enablement company focused on seniors who have historically lacked access to affordable, high-quality healthcare

We aim to provide great care, in a sustainable way, by having a business model built around improving medical outcomes while lowering avoidable costs. We do this while taking a holistic approach to understanding the health needs and social risk factors of those under our care. This strategy is underpinned by our proprietary software platform, the Clover Assistant, which is designed to aggregate patient data from across the health ecosystem to support clinical decision-making by presenting physicians and other providers with real-time, personalized recommendations at the point of care.

Making care more accessible is at the heart of our business, and we believe patients should have the freedom to choose their doctors. We offer affordable Medicare Advantage plans with extensive benefits, provide primary care physicians with the Clover Assistant, and also make comprehensive home-based care available via the Clover Home Care program.

With our corporate headquarters in Nashville, Clover’s workforce is distributed around the U.S. and also includes a team of world-class technologists based in Hong Kong. We manage care for Medicare Advantage members in Alabama, Arizona, Georgia, Mississippi,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, South Carolina, Tennessee, and Texas.
